2. Built on HTML5 for Seamless Integration

One of the key technological reasons for Jili’s rise is its decision to develop all games using HTML5 technology. Unlike outdated Flash-based games or bulky native apps, HTML5 offers a streamlined, lightweight, and cross-platform solution that is perfect for modern gaming environments.

This means that Jili’s games can run directly in browsers without requiring players to download additional plugins or software. The result? Instant accessibility, better performance, and smoother gameplay—regardless of device or operating system.

For casino operators and aggregators, HTML5 also means easier integration and fewer technical hurdles when adding Jili’s games to their platforms. It’s a win-win for both sides: operators get high-performance content, and players enjoy instant play with no compromises on visuals or features.

4. A Diverse and Engaging Game Portfolio

Another key to Jili’s disruptive power is the range and versatility of its game offerings. Jili isn’t limited to one genre or player type. Instead, the studio offers a growing library of:

  • Slot games: Classic, themed, and progressive slots with multi-feature bonuses.
  • Fishing games: Real-time, interactive shooting games popular in Asia.
  • Arcade-style games: Skill-based and quick-play games that offer a different form of engagement.
  • Mini-games: Light, casual titles perfect for short gaming sessions.

Each title is designed with a focus on visual flair, intuitive mechanics, and high replay value. Jili also places emphasis on thematic diversity, with games that draw from global mythology, pop culture, history, and original IPs.

This variety keeps players engaged and allows operators to cater to a broader demographic—something that not every developer can offer.
